GET /search
Search for concepts or collections based on various criteria.

Unterst├╝tzte Formate

html, ttl, rdf

Beispiele

GET /search.ttl
200

# omitted namespace definitions
<http://try.iqvoc.net/search.ttl?l=en&q=dance&t=labels> a sdc:Query;
                                                        sdc:totalResults 1;
                                                        sdc:itemsPerPage 40;
                                                        sdc:searchTerms "dance";
                                                        sdc:first <http://try.iqvoc.net/search.ttl?l=en&page=1&q=dance&t=labels>;
                                                        sdc:last <http://try.iqvoc.net/search.ttl?l=en&page=1&q=dance&t=labels>;
                                                        sdc:result search:result1.
<http://try.iqvoc.net/search.ttl?l=en&page=1&q=dance&t=labels> a sdc:Page;
                                                               sdc:startIndex 1.
search:result1 a sdc:Result;
               sdc:link :dance;
               skos:prefLabel "Dance"@en.

Parameter

Parametername Beschreibung
q
verpflichtend

Query term (URL-encoded, if necessary). Wild cards are not supported, see the qt parameter below.

Validations:

  • Must be String

qt
optional

Query type

Validations:

  • Must be one of: exact, contains, begins_with, ends_with.

t
verpflichtend

Specifies the properties to be searched.

Validations:

  • Must be one of: labels, pref_labels, notes.

for
optional

The result type you are searching for.

Validations:

  • Must be one of: concept, collection, all.

l[]
verpflichtend

One or more languages of the labels or notes to be queried. Use 2-letter language codes from ISO 639.1.

Validations:

  • Must be one of: de, en.

c
optional

Constrains results to members of the given collection ID.

Validations:

  • Must be String

ds[]
optional

Specifies one or more external data sets (connected thesauri)to include in search.

Validations:

  • Must be String